Common Lock Installation & Rekey Problems We See in Shiloh Homes
- Freeze-thaw cycles destroy exterior cylinders. North-central Ohio’s freeze-thaw cycles through winter and early spring cause moisture infiltration in exterior lock cylinders - particularly on unheated outbuildings - leading to seized pins and broken keys that spike service calls after hard overnight freezes. We see this most in January through March, when a barn that was fine in November suddenly won’t open.
- Old mortise locks reach end-of-life with no replacement parts. Shiloh’s residential stock is dominated by older farmhouses and modest early-to-mid 20th-century homes typical of small north-central Ohio villages, many retaining original or dated mortise locks, skeleton-key hardware, and aging deadbolts that are increasingly hard to source parts for. We evaluate each piece honestly: some can be rebuilt, others need respectful retrofitting.
- Mismatched padlocks create operational chaos. Multi-structure farm properties with mismatched padlocks and no unified key system are common in Shiloh. The owner carries a ring of twelve keys, can’t remember which opens what, and eventually forces the wrong key until something breaks. A single keyed-alike consultation solves this permanently.

Moisture enters lock cylinders through worn gaskets or keyway gaps, then freezes overnight into ice that binds the pin tumblers solid. Forcing the key snaps it inside the cylinder, turning a simple thaw into an extraction and replacement. In Shiloh’s unheated barns and sheds, this is predictable - we recommend annual lubrication with graphite or Teflon-based products, and we carry replacement cylinders rated for exterior exposure when the original hardware fails.
